Israeli Army Conducts Several Incursions into Syrian Territory
ARK News.. The Israel Defense Forces carried out several incursions into villages in the countryside of Daraa and Quneitra in southern Syria, according to a Syrian media source.
According to Syria TV, an Israeli force entered the village of Ain Zakar in western Daraa on Sunday, March 15, 2026, where it established a military checkpoint and cut off the road linking the villages of Ain Zakar and al-Muqraz, while inspecting passersby.
The source added that an Israeli patrol consisting of six military vehicles entered the village of Sayda al‑Golan in southern Quneitra before withdrawing toward the village of Al‑Hanout and continuing its movement toward the Tal al‑Sajeh Military Base.
Other sources also reported that another Israeli force, consisting of 24 military vehicles, advanced into the area between the towns of Tarnaja and Jubata al‑Khashab in the Quneitra countryside.
